Web18 mei 2024 · “’Crazy’ is a strongly gendered insult in that it is rarely used against men, and the purpose is to discredit the speaker without regard for the content of their concern,” says Nicole Prause, Ph.D., a psychologist and neuroscientist at the Libero Center in Los Angeles. Delegitimizing your partner’s feelings is a cop-out when you don’t want to deal. Web1 apr. 2013 · 3. A sense of entitlement. Your husband expects preferential treatment from you and all others.
